Sisällysluettelo:
- Vaihe 1: Materiaalit ja työkalut
- Vaihe 2: Luonnos pääpaneelin asetteluksi
- Vaihe 3: Poraa ja leikkaa paneelireiät
- Vaihe 4: Asenna sähkölaatikot paneeliin
- Vaihe 5: Kytke kytkimet
- Vaihe 6: Kiinnitä kytkimet sähkölaatikoihin
- Vaihe 7: Leikkaa RGB -LED -johdot
- Vaihe 8: Asenna LEDit paneeliin
- Vaihe 9: Poraa reiät painikkeelle ja pietsolle
- Vaihe 10: Maalaa paneeli
- Vaihe 11: Leikkaa ja asenna Ping Pong -pallo -LED -suojat
- Vaihe 12: Asenna kytkinlevyn suojukset
- Vaihe 13: Kiinnitä painike ja pietso
- Vaihe 14: Asenna ja juota vastukset
- Vaihe 15: Kytke piiri
- Vaihe 16: Asenna Arduino
- Vaihe 17: Lisää paristot ja virtakytkin
- Vaihe 18: Koodaa Arduino
- Vaihe 19: Testaa, nauti ja jopa muokkaa
Video: Kid's Toy Light Switch Box + Games Remix: 19 vaihetta (kuvilla)
2024 Kirjoittaja: John Day | [email protected]. Viimeksi muokattu: 2024-01-30 09:01
Tämä on remix, joka minun piti tehdä siitä lähtien, kun näin kaksi mahtavaa ohjetta, enkä voinut lakata ajattelemasta näiden kahden yhdistämistä! Tämä mashup yhdistää periaatteessa Light Switch Boxin käyttöliittymän yksinkertaisiin peleihin (Simon, Whack-a-Mole jne.) Arduinolla. Kuten Light Switch Boxin alkuperäinen kirjoittaja mainitsee, minulla ei ole aavistustakaan siitä, miksi pikkulapset rakastavat leikkiä valokytkimillä niin paljon, mutta tämä projekti antaa heille korjauksen! Muokkasin yksinkertaista elektroniikkaa lisäämään Simon Arduino -pelin ja sitten useita pelitiloja, jotta myös vanhemmat lapseni voivat pelata! Tein myös yhden merkittävän parannuksen LEDeille ja käytin pingpongipalloja hajottamaan LEDit, koska se näyttää paljon viileämmältä kuin alkuperäinen!
Sen pitäisi olla helppo tapa päästä elektroniikkaan ja viedä se yhden askeleen pidemmälle yksinkertaiseen Arduino'ingiin. Katso alkuperäinen inspiraatio - tässä linkit!
- Lasten lelujen valokytkinrasia
- Peli Arduino Simon sanoo
Sen lisäksi - motivaationi:
4 lastani merkitsevät minulle kaikkea.
Nuorena juuri nyt (7, 5, 3 ja 1) se vaatii paljon huomiota ja työtä pitääkseen kaikki järkevinä! Se ei jätä paljon aikaa tinkimiseen, Arduinoon, ohjeiden kirjoittamiseen jne. Mutta kummallista on, että juuri tällaiset projektit ja harrastukset pitävät minut järkevänä. Tunteeko kukaan muu samoin? Mistä tahansa surullisesta, kummallisesta syystä, jonka vaimoni yrittää todella ymmärtää (siunatkoon hänen sydäntään), rakastan ehdottomasti sitä, että minut imeytyy tuntikausia hyvään projektiin, joka saa luovan ajatteluni käyntiin, saa minut ratkaisemaan ongelmat ja antaa minulle mahdollisuus käytännön suunnitteluun.
Ja sitä rakastan Instructablesissa !
Saan nähdä intohimon toisten projekteissa - niin paljon hienoja ideoita ja mieleni alkaa kilpailla! Joten ainakin kun suunnittelen projektia kohti lapsiani juuri nyt ja otan heidät mukaan prosessiin, minusta tuntuu, että annan heille maun rakastamistani harrastuksista. Ja kuka tietää? Ehkä jonain päivänä heistä tulee kuuluisia keksijöitä, suunnittelijoita, yrittäjiä, hakkereita jne. Mutta niin kauan kuin he voivat olla luovia ja löytää intohimoa työssään, kaikki on sen arvoista.
Aloitetaan!
Vaihe 1: Materiaalit ja työkalut
Materiaaliluettelo:
- (1) 1 "x10" levy (tarvitaan noin 12 "-18")
- (4) yksinapaiset valokytkimet
- (4) valokytkimen seinälevyt
- (4) muoviset "vanhat työt" sähkölaatikot
- (2) valkoiset pingispallot
- (4) AA -paristot
- (4) RGB 10mm LEDit
- (1) Painokytkin
- (1) Pietsosummeri (tai kaiutin)
- (5) 100 ohmin vastukset
- (1) 220 ohmin vastus
- (1) 4xAA -paristopidike
- (1) Liukukytkin
- (1) Arduino Uno
Työkaluluettelo:
- Palapeli
- Poranterä (1 1/2 "tasainen poranterä, 1/2" litteä poranterä, sitten vakio 1/2 ", 1/4", 1/16 ")
- Ruuvitaltat (ristipää ja litteä pää)
- Mittanauha
- Yleisveitsi
- Hiekkapaperi ja maali (valinnainen)
- Juotin ja juote
- Langanpoistimet
- Kuuma liimapistooli
- Viivotin
- Lyijykynä
- Sakset
Vaihe 2: Luonnos pääpaneelin asetteluksi
Paneelin luomiseen tarvitset laudan tai laatikon, jossa on vähintään tilaa pääpaneelissa 4 valokytkimelle ja 4 pingispallolle. Noin 14 "8" on pienin, jonka haluat sopia tähän. Alkuperäisessä lasten leluvalokytkinlaatikossa Ben suosittelee ostamaan puulaatikon tähän projektiin, mutta tein tällä hetkellä 1 "x 10" levyn.
- Ota lauta (tai laatikon kansi) ja aseta kytkimet ja pingispallot (18 "9 1/4" suunnittelussani)
- Mittaa levyn pohjasta ja merkitse kuinka pitkälle haluat kytkimien asetettavan (1 1/2 "mallissani)
- Piirrä viivaimella viivaimella suora viiva näiden merkintöjen poikki
- Tee sama yläriville, johon haluat sijoittaa pingispallopallot (2 tuumaa suunnittelussani)
- Etsi seuraavaksi laudan keskipiste mittaamalla sen pituus ja merkitse keskiviiva
- Käytä symmetrisiä etäisyyksiä keskeltä kummaltakin puolelta samalla etäisyydellä sähkölaatikoista ja pingispalloista
- Piirrä kytkentälaatikot ja merkitse yläriville jokaisen kytkimen keskikohta, johon pingispallo menee
- (Huomaa: Älä huolehdi kynäviivoista olettaen, että maalaat tai hioat valmistetun levyn.)
Vaihe 3: Poraa ja leikkaa paneelireiät
Sähkölaatikon suorakulmioiden leikkaaminen:
- Poraa 1/4 "reikiä jokaisen suorakulmion jokaiseen kulmaan kuvan mukaisesti
- Leikkaa jokainen suorakulmio palapelin avulla reikien yhdistämiseksi sivuilla, yläosassa ja bottossa
Ping Pong Ball -reikien valmistelu:
- Käytä jokaisen 4 pingispongin merkin kohdalla ensin 1 1/2 "poranterää aloittaaksesi reiän, johon kansi menee
- Varoitus: Täällä poraat vain noin 1/8 "alas puuhun !!! Riittää huulille.
- Kun olet valmistanut 1 1/2 "reiän, poraa jokaisen reiän keskikohta 1/4" poranterällä
Vaihe 4: Asenna sähkölaatikot paneeliin
- Kiinnitä seuraavaksi jokainen sähkölaatikko liu'uttamalla ne reikään varmistaen, että ylhäällä ja alhaalla olevat kielekkeet ovat kotelon vieressä.
- Kun olet varmistanut, että sähkölaatikko on täysin paikallaan (etupinnan tasalla), ruuvaa ylä- ja alaosa sisään.
- Varmista, että näiden "vanhojen töiden" laatikoiden kielekkeet päätyvät ulos ja tarttuvat levyn takaosaan, mikä tekee siitä tiukan.
- Varoitus: Älä kiristä liikaa tai muovia voi rikkoutua !!
Vaihe 5: Kytke kytkimet
- Katkaise ja irrota noin 1/2 tuumaa kahden johdon reunoista kullekin valokytkimelle.
- (Noin 12 " - 14" on eniten tarvitset, jotta se voi ulottua paneelin poikki.)
- Liitä johto valokytkimen kumpaankin sivuruuviin.
Vaihe 6: Kiinnitä kytkimet sähkölaatikoihin
- Käännä paneeli taaksepäin käyttämällä ruuvitalttaa tai pihtejä ponnahtaaksesi ulos jokaisen 4 sähkökotelon ylälangan kielekkeistä.
- Käännä paneeli takaisin eteen, pujota langan päät avoimen kielekkeen läpi ja kierrä jokainen kytkin sisään.
Vaihe 7: Leikkaa RGB -LED -johdot
Minusta on yksinkertaisinta (ja ehkä jopa halvinta) ostaa vain suuri määrä RGB -LED -valoja ja sitten valita minkä tahansa värin haluan projektiin. Jos sinulla on jo punaisia, sinisiä, vihreitä ja keltaisia LED -valoja, ohita tämä vaihe. Kaikille muille johtimien, joita emme käytä, leikkaaminen jokaisesta LEDistä auttaa meitä olemaan hämmentynyt.
- Jokaisessa yleisessä katodin RGB -LEDissä pisin johto on GND ja sitä käytetään aina
- Katkaise kaaviossa esitetyt tarpeettomat johdot kullekin LED -valolle lankaleikkureilla/katkaisimilla
- Kuten kaaviosta näet, keltainen tehdään punaisella ja vihreällä johdolla
- Huomautus: Yritä olla sekoittamatta LED -valoja johtojen katkaisun jälkeen, mutta jos teet niin, katso vain kaaviota erottaaksesi ne toisistaan.
Vaihe 8: Asenna LEDit paneeliin
Lisää kuumalla liimapistoolilla liimaa jokaisen LED -valon alapuolelle ja työnnä johdot reiän läpi liimaamalla se paneelin etuosaan. (Täällä haluat varmistaa, että asetat LED -värit valitsemasi järjestykseen).
Vaihe 9: Poraa reiät painikkeelle ja pietsolle
Tässä vaiheessa päätin lisätä painikekytkimen (lukituslaitteen) paneelin etuosaan avustamaan tilojen vaihtamisessa. Jos haluat tehdä vain yhden tilan Arduinolla, voit jättää tämän kytkimen huomiotta.
- Poraa 1/2 "reikä painonappikytkimelle halutessasi (minun kohdalla se oli linjassa LEDien ja paneelin keskikohdan kanssa)
- Käännä seuraavaksi paneeli ympäri ja poraa 1/2 ": n litteällä poranterällä suurin osa puusta, kunnes vain terän kärki murtautuu etupuolelle. (Tämä reikä on pietsolle - ilman pientä reikä, ääni vaimenee.)
Vaihe 10: Maalaa paneeli
Maalaa tai ruiskuta sitten paneeli. Jos pidät minusta, et halua poistaa kytkimiä, peitä ne vain teipillä. (Tai jos olisin ajatellut sitä aikaisemmin, olisin maalannut ennen LEDien ja kytkinten asentamista)
Vaihe 11: Leikkaa ja asenna Ping Pong -pallo -LED -suojat
Käytetyt pingispallot toimivat täällä hienosti, mutta ne on puhdistettava ensin. Käytä likaisia pingispallopalloja hieman astianpesuainetta ja pese sormillasi ja kuivaa sitten. (Näiden kuvien pingispallot olivat hyvin käytettyjä ja näyttivät paljon erilaisilta ennen pesua!)
- Ota jokainen pingispallopallo ja leikkaa pallo varovasti apuohjelmalla tai tarkalla veitsellä alas keskisaumasta. (Kun pidät palloa valoa vasten, sinun pitäisi nähdä sauma.)
- Leikkaa seuraavaksi saksilla reunan ympäri ja leikkaa noin 1/8 " - 1/4" pidemmälle, kunnes kansi mahtuu 1 1/2 "pyöreään uraan.
- Asenna jokainen pingispallopallo painamalla kevyesti toista puolta aukkoon ja kevyesti pallon reunat aukon sisään.
- Omat sopivat niin tiukasti, ettei liimaa tarvittu. Lisää tarvittaessa kuumaa liimaa takaosaan, kun asetat ne aukkoon.
- Huomautus: Jos pallosuojus ei sovi, leikkaa hieman alareunasta, kunnes saat sen paikkaan. Voi olla hyvä harjoitella yhden pallon asentamista oikean koon saamiseksi ja leikata sitten muut samalla tavalla.
Vaihe 12: Asenna kytkinlevyn suojukset
Asenna kytkinlevyn suojukset litteällä ruuvitaltalla.
Vaihe 13: Kiinnitä painike ja pietso
- Työnnä painike etureiän läpi ja pidä paikallaan lisätäksesi kuumaa liimaa takaosaan, kunnes se on kuiva.
- Irrota pietson kansi ja työnnä aukkoon. Käytä kuumaa liimaa pitämään se paikallaan.
Vaihe 14: Asenna ja juota vastukset
Joten tällaisissa yksinkertaisissa elektroniikkaprojekteissa, joissa on minimaalinen määrä komponentteja, mieluummin yksinkertainen tapa yhdistää vastukset ja johdot suoraan puulevyyn. Poraamalla pienet reiät levyyn komponenttijohtoja varten, ne voivat pysyä helposti paikallaan juottamisen aikana!
- Ensinnäkin, levyn takana on LED -valojen värit ja johdot + ja - (muista, että sivu on pisin)
- Lisäksi keltaisessa LED -tarrassa molemmat positiiviset liittimet, joissa on R (punainen) ja G (vihreä), koska siinä on kaksi johtoa
- Poraa puuhun 1/8 "tai 1/16" pieni reikä jokaisen levyn reiästä tulevan LED -johdon viereen
- Varoitus: Älä poraa koko levyä eteenpäin! Vain 1/4 " - 1/2" reikä, johon voit syöttää johdot.
- Taivuta varovasti LED -johtimien yli ja työnnä reikään
- Poraa seuraavaksi 1/8 "tai 1/16" pieni reikä noin tuuman etäisyydelle kunkin LED -valon positiivisista+ -napoista
- Kirjoita kaavion perusteella vastuksen koko, joka kattaa tämän aukon
- Seuraavaksi taita tai leikkaa vastusjohdot ja katkaise jokainen rako sopivalla vastuksella
- Juotosraudan ja juotteen avulla komponenttijohtojen tulee koskettaa ja voit nyt juottaa jokaisen reiän kohdalla
- Lopuksi laita kuumaa liimaa jokaiseen liitäntään pitämään komponentit ja johdot levylle paremmin.
Vaihe 15: Kytke piiri
Liitä LEDit, vastukset, painike, pietso, valokytkimet ja Arduino kaavion mukaan. Jokainen kaavion musta viiva on liitetty Arduinon maahan (GND). Samoin kuin vastukset, on helpointa porata reikä puuhun, syöttää kaikki maadoitusjohdot reikään juotettavaksi yhdessä yhdellä langalla, joka johtaa nippusta arduinoon. Käytä jälleen kuumaa liimaa kiinnittääksesi johdot haluamaasi paikkaan.
Vaihe 16: Asenna Arduino
Aseta Arduino paneelin takaosaan ja kiinnitä levyyn ruuveilla sivujen pienien reikien tai vahvan teipin läpi.
Vaihe 17: Lisää paristot ja virtakytkin
Jos et halua käyttää korttia USB -virtalähteestä, lisää piiriin 4AA -paristoa akulla. Pienen liukukytkimen lisääminen positiivisen navan ja Arduinon väliin mahdollistaa virran kytkemisen päälle ja pois päältä, koska tavallinen Arduino Uno ja LED -valot tyhjentävät paristot nopeasti.
Vaihe 18: Koodaa Arduino
Simon Saysin alkuperäinen koodi toimi hyvin tässä projektissa, mutta minun piti tehdä joitain muutoksia sisällyttääkseni yksinkertaisen kytkimen siirtämisen LED -valojen ja muiden tilojen kautta. Videossa näkyy toiminnallisuus ja alla on valmiiden pelien koodi.
Vaihe 19: Testaa, nauti ja jopa muokkaa
Kun kaikki on kytketty, testaa piiri ja toiminta. En ole vielä lisännyt takaosaani (laatikkoa) omalleni, mutta lapset rakastavat sitä! Päätän vain sulkea sen muutamalla puukappaleella tai laittaa paneelin leikkialueelle. Hyvää lasten peliä! Voit vapaasti lisätä omaa logiikkaasi ja pelejä tähän yksinkertaiseen kokoonpanoon!
Suositeltava:
ESP32 VGA Arcade Games ja ohjaussauva: 6 vaihetta (kuvilla)
ESP32 VGA Arcade Games ja ohjaussauva: Tässä ohjeessa näytän kuinka toistaa neljä arcade -tyyppistä peliä - Tetris - Snake - Breakout - Bomber - käyttämällä ESP32 -laitetta, VGA -näytön ulostulolla. Resoluutio on 320 x 200 pikseliä, 8 väriä. Olen aikaisemmin tehnyt version
Dinosauruspeli Hack Google Chrome Games: 9 vaihetta
Dinosaur Game Hack Google Chrome Games: chrome t-rex run on erittäin hauska peli. Täällä aiomme tehdä siitä viihdyttävämmän käyttämällä Arduinoa. Tämä dino -peli ei näy internetyhteyssivulla.Voit tehdä tämän myös käyttämällä vadelma pi: tä, vertaamme molempia levyjä yksityiskohtaisesti Arduino
Kääntäjä Bro's (Indie Games): 3 vaihetta
Compiler Bro's (Indie Games): Compiler Bro's: Pelin pelaaminen on niin hauskaa …….. mutta onnistuu ??? Onko Quorassa kysyttävää :) Rakennuspeli on täydellinen harjoitus, jolla voit laittaa koodaustaitosi ja tietosi, eivätkä kaikki rakenna peliä … Olen itse oppinut yhtenäisyyden f
Arduino Arcade Lego Games Box: 19 vaihetta (kuvilla)
Arduino Arcade Lego Games Box: Jos sinulla on lapsia, sinulla on todennäköisesti samat ongelmat kuin meillä heille ostetuilla Lego -sarjoilla. He kokoontuvat ja leikkivät heidän kanssaan, mutta jonkin ajan kuluttua sarjat muuttuvat yhdeksi tiilikasaksi. Lapset kasvavat, etkä tiedä mitä tehdä
Anarc Console De Games Com Raspberry PI: 5 vaihetta
Anarc Console De Games Com Raspberry PI: Projeto Anarc Console de Games Port á til com Arduino ja Raspberry Pi Projeto ANARC é uma peliportin pelikonsoli á til feito com Arduino, Raspberry Pi, tela de 7 ″ ja 5 tunnin akut. Yksi permite jogar co